Boot camps are sanctions based on shock incarceration grounded in military techniques. The basic idea behind boot camps is that its forced labor and "tough-love" components will instill a sense of discipline and self-motivation in the juveniles that will carry on past the initial boot camp experience.

Despite their popularity, there is little evidence to show that boot camps are effective. Some studies also suggest that boot camps may cause more harm than good.
